Output ec94f42a3a3a0ff941d259d262d4521804eae96fac554f9ec8eef5c935f4fbb3:33

value
3271386
script pubkey
OP_0 OP_PUSHBYTES_20 dc952d84c0c076baa5e94f58e5dd16b54e8b5b59
address
bc1qmj2jmpxqcpmt4f0ffavwthgkk48gkk6ej4l42c
transaction
ec94f42a3a3a0ff941d259d262d4521804eae96fac554f9ec8eef5c935f4fbb3
confirmations
150643
spent
true